Additionally, Al-Khaif serves as a beacon of knowledge and scholarship within the Shia community. Scholars and theologians often convene here to deliberate on essential matters of faith, disseminating wisdom among believers. This intellectual discourse nurtures a culture of inquiry, encouraging adherents to engage with their beliefs critically. The mosque, in this light, is not merely a site for worship but a vibrant hub of spiritual learning and guidance.
